Hi Jen, I think this is an excellent idea. I wonder if there has 
already been feasibility work done on these possibilities, or if 
individuals might have advice about their own experiences? It sounds 
like a great idea for a workshop at the next documentary conference (in 
Melbourne) if it is not already on the list... The SPAA / ASDA 
Documentary Council's draft report (SADC/'Creative Strategies'/Higgs 
Report) suggests the establishment of an "Ozdoxs" site (borrowing the 
'brand' from the mob doing such a good job in documentary cultural 
events in Sydney) for this kind of work - it is one of the better ideas 
in an otherwise blisteringly disappointing excercise. Best JH

> Hi all,
> I am considering researching and developing a self distribution 
> strategy, to
> include an 'outreach kit' for independent doco makers to assist them
> Self distribute when they cannot get a commercial distributor.
> The idea regarding the 'need' has come from having short docos myself 
> that
> could reach wider audiences, and the TTGJ (Time to go john) experience 
> - I
> think many of these short films could reach more people both in Aust 
> and the
> TTGJ feature in other English speaking countries. The Idea for the
> 'solution' has come from www.mediarights.org
> To begin with the information could be on-line, ultimately it may need 
> a
> hard copy which could be sold.
> What does everyone think?
> Jen Hughes
